Select a pertinent topic to the job that is being finished and connect it back to http://juliusxnjs162.lucialpiazzale.com/nationwide-fall-safety-and-security-stand certain examples of what is taking place on your specific work site. Include the workers in a discussion by asking concerns as well as asking for experiences relating to the subject of the day.

Generally, once a week business conferences are recommended but will differ from company to business. Discuss appropriate safety issues-- Do not discuss topics that do not apply to your work. Both companies as well as employees have functions to play in keeping a secure workplace.

While OSHA does not particularly call for a firm to hold safety and security talks or toolbox talks in any one of their criteria, doing so can play a part in aiding to make certain conformity with some requirements. For example, OSHA calls for that employers make workers familiar with the risks of the work that they do as well as how to remove them.
